DocumentCode :
2047447
Title :
The monitoring request interface (MRI)
Author :
Kereku, Edmond ; Gerndt, Michael
Author_Institution :
Inst. fur Informatik, Technische Univ. Munchen, Germany
fYear :
2006
fDate :
25-29 April 2006
Abstract :
In this paper, we present MRI, a high level interface for selective monitoring of code regions and data structures in single and multiprocessor environments. MRI keeps transparent the available monitoring resources from the performance analysis tools and can electively generate monitoring results as online profile information, or as postmortem traces. MRI is the first step toward a standard monitoring interface which can be used by a broad range of performance analysis tools, from profiler tools, trace producers and visualizers, up to complex automatic performance analyzers. We also present an implementation of MRI for SMPs which transparently use a simulation backend and a PAPI backend to obtain performance data.
Keywords :
application program interfaces; data structures; multiprocessing systems; PAPI backend; SMP; code regions monitoring; data structure; high level interface; monitoring request interface; multiprocessor; online profile information; performance analysis tool; single processor; Application software; Computerized monitoring; Counting circuits; Data structures; Data visualization; Hardware; Information analysis; Magnetic resonance imaging; Performance analysis; Runtime; C API; Cache; Instrumentation; Interface; Monitoring; Performance Analysis;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Parallel and Distributed Processing Symposium, 2006. IPDPS 2006. 20th International
Print_ISBN :
1-4244-0054-6
Type :
conf
DOI :
10.1109/IPDPS.2006.1639495
Filename :
1639495
Link To Document :
بازگشت